The Staffing and Efficiency Squeeze in Oakland Healthcare Operations
Healthcare operations in the Bay Area are grappling with significant labor cost inflation. For organizations of Alameda Health System's approximate size, staffing represents a substantial portion of operational expenditure, often ranging from 50-70% of total costs, according to industry analyses. The tight labor market in California means that attracting and retaining qualified administrative and support staff can lead to wage increases of 5-10% annually, impacting overall profitability. Furthermore, patient expectations for seamless scheduling, faster check-ins, and immediate responses to inquiries are rising, placing strain on existing administrative workflows. Many similar-sized practices report front-desk call volumes increasing by 15-20% year-over-year, overwhelming current staffing levels.
Navigating Market Consolidation and Competitive Pressures in California
The healthcare landscape in California, much like national trends seen in segments like primary care and specialty clinics, is marked by increasing consolidation. Larger health systems and private equity-backed groups are acquiring smaller practices and operational units, driving a need for greater efficiency and scalability among independent operators. This PE roll-up activity often results in competitors with significant technological advantages and optimized operational models. Benchmarks from healthcare management consulting firms indicate that organizations that fail to adopt efficiency-boosting technologies risk same-store margin compression, with some segments seeing declines of 2-4% annually if operational overhead is not managed effectively. Peers in adjacent sectors, such as dental support organizations, are already seeing consolidators leverage AI for administrative tasks.
The Imperative for AI Adoption in Oakland's Healthcare Administration
AI agent deployments are moving from experimental to essential for administrative functions within healthcare operations. For organizations in Oakland and across California, the ability to automate routine tasks like appointment scheduling, patient intake, billing inquiries, and insurance verification can yield substantial operational lift. Industry studies suggest that AI-powered solutions can reduce administrative task completion times by 20-30%, freeing up staff to focus on more complex patient interactions and care coordination. Furthermore, AI can improve data accuracy and reduce claim denials, a critical factor given that claim denial rates can range from 5-15% for many healthcare providers, as reported by healthcare finance groups. The window for implementing these technologies before they become industry standard is rapidly closing, with projections indicating that companies not leveraging AI for operational efficiency within the next 12-24 months may face significant competitive disadvantages.
Enhancing Patient Experience Through Intelligent Operations
Beyond internal efficiencies, AI agents are poised to transform the patient experience, a key differentiator in the competitive Oakland healthcare market. Patients increasingly expect digital-first engagement, similar to trends seen in retail and banking. AI-powered chatbots and virtual assistants can provide 24/7 patient support, answering frequently asked questions, guiding patients through pre-visit requirements, and facilitating post-visit follow-ups. This not only improves patient satisfaction but also reduces the burden on human staff. For businesses like Alameda Health System, implementing AI can lead to improved patient retention and a stronger reputation for modern, accessible care. Benchmarks from patient experience surveys show that organizations with highly responsive digital engagement channels see patient satisfaction scores increase by 10-15%.

Automated Patient Intake and Registration
Streamlining patient intake reduces administrative burden and improves patient experience. Many healthcare systems struggle with manual data entry, leading to errors and delays. Automating this process allows staff to focus on direct patient care and complex administrative tasks.
Intelligent Appointment Scheduling and Optimization
Efficient appointment scheduling is critical for maximizing provider utilization and patient access. Manual scheduling is prone to errors, double-bookings, and under-utilization of resources. AI can optimize schedules based on provider availability, patient needs, and urgency.
Automated Medical Records Coding and Billing Support
Accurate and timely medical coding and billing are essential for revenue cycle management. Manual coding is complex, time-consuming, and susceptible to errors that can lead to claim denials and delayed payments. AI can assist in identifying appropriate codes and streamlining the billing process.
Proactive Patient Outreach and Follow-up
Effective patient follow-up improves adherence to treatment plans and reduces readmission rates. Many patients miss crucial post-visit instructions or follow-up appointments due to lack of timely reminders or accessible information. AI can automate personalized outreach.
AI-Powered Clinical Documentation Improvement (CDI)
High-quality clinical documentation is vital for accurate coding, appropriate reimbursement, and continuity of care. Gaps or ambiguities in documentation can lead to retrospective audits and financial penalties. AI can identify areas needing clarification from clinicians.
Automated Prior Authorization Processing
The prior authorization process is a significant administrative bottleneck, consuming valuable staff time and delaying patient care. Manual submission and tracking of these requests are inefficient and prone to errors. AI can automate large portions of this workflow.
